Transaction d36fdfaca41a9ebea1345d35bb79c517ebeb3da4bfe1b5eb2870564ddcdb7c81

3 Input
1 Outputs
  • d36fdfaca41a9ebea1345d35bb79c517ebeb3da4bfe1b5eb2870564ddcdb7c81:0
  • value  1631730
    address  35b4hhACzifp1Kuu4jcUuXcJE6j6PP5ivN